Buttermilk Fried Chicken with Creamy Gravy
Crispy air-fried chicken breast marinated in tangy buttermilk and served with a velvety herb gravy for a comforting, protein-packed meal.
INGREDIENTS
5 oz chicken breast
0.25 cup low-fat buttermilk
2 tbsp arrowroot powder
0.5 tbsp avocado oil
0.25 tsp sea salt
0.25 tsp black pepper
0.25 tsp garlic powder
0.25 tsp onion powder
0.25 tsp smoked paprika
0.25 cup chicken bone broth
1 tbsp unsweetened almond milk
PREPARATION
Place the chicken breast in a shallow dish and cover with buttermilk; marinate in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es.
In a separate shallow bowl, whisk together the arrowroot powder, sea salt, black p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, and smoked paprika.
Remove the chicken from the buttermilk, letting the excess liquid drip off, then dredge thoroughly in the seasoned arrowroot mixture until fully coated.
Heat the avocado o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at and cook the chicken for 5 to 6 minutes per side until the crust is golden-brown and the internal temperature reaches 165°F.
Remove the chicken from the pan to rest; pour the chicken bone broth and almond milk into the same skillet, whisking constantly to incorporate the pan drippings until the gravy thickens into a smooth sauce.
